Veterinary Hospital and Clinic. Sunrise Animal Hospital was purchased in May of 1987 by Dr. Hendrik DeZeeuw, and the company was incorporated in December of that same year. Dr. Sanjay Ralhan joined the company in 1990 and in 1995 he formed a partnership with Dr. DeZeeuw. The original location of Sunrise Animal Hospital was at 1 Sunrise Avenue in Mount Pearl, NL. Land was purchased at Park Avenue and after the construction of the new hospital was complete, the new and improved Sunrise Animal Hospital opened for business on December 31 2007. Today Sunrise Animal Hospital Ltd. has two Hospitals. The Torbay Road Animal Hospital opened in 1997 and is located at 286 Torbay Rd, Coaker's Meadow Plaza in St. John's NL. The company started with 1 vet and 4 support staff. As of October, 2013, the company has 64 employees, including 10 full time vets, 1 part-time vet, 4 registered vet techs and 49 support staff.

Partnar Animal Health was founded in 2004 by Greg Shewfelt. As a science graduate from the University of Guelph, and with an MBA from Durham University in the UK, Greg's education coupled with a track record of success in the global animal health industry provided the platform in which to launch this new venture. Developing partnerships has been a key to this company's success. All people and companies have specific areas of knowledge and skills wherein they excel. By partnering with others, Partnar Animal Health has been able to access knowledge and capabilities far beyond that of which a small company on its own could be capable of. Partnar was initially focused on marketing products for bovine and equine embryo transfer in North America. To support these market activities, the company has warehouses located in both St. Joseph, Missouri and Ilderton, Ontario. In Canada, seeing opportunities arising from industry consolidation, the company broadened its market scope and began to register and market veterinary products that larger animal health companies had discontinued. With this core of registered veterinary drugs, Partnar further expanded its product offering by partnering with other manufacturers looking for distribution in the Canadian market. As a result of the success Partnar has enjoyed by implementing these strategies, the company now boasts a sales force of six people covering Canada from coast to coast.

Prairie Diagnostic Services Inc
Prairie Diagnostic Services Inc.(PDS) is a member type non-profit corporation dedicated to providing veterinary diagnostic services. Its members are the Province of Saskatchewan and the University of Saskatchewan. PDS is located at the Western College of Veterinary Medicine (WCVM) in Saskatoon with laboratories integrated directly into the College. The laboratory provides a full range of diagnostic services including: necropsy, surgical pathology, clinical pathology, histology, bacteriology, immunology, molecular diagnostics, virology, and toxicology. A contract lab at WCVM provides endocrinology services.

Toronto Veterinary Emergency And Referral Hospital
The referral service was originally located at Morningside and founded by Dr A. Gillick in 1974 and was relocated to our new facility, the Toronto Veterinary Emergency Hospital in Oct 2009. We are located at 21 Rolark Drive. Our emergency clinic provides onsite 24/7 Emergency care by experienced emergency clinicians and technicians. Our Critical Care Service (ICU) is overseen by our certified specialist in emergency and critical care medicine. Referral Service - Our specialists have extensive training in a wide variety of services including: Surgery: Orthopedics, arthroscopy, laparoscopy, reconstructive surgery, oncology, joint replacement Medical Services: Disease management, diagnostic and endoscopic procedures, chemotherapy, nutritional management Diagnostic Imaging: Inpatient and outpatient ultrasound services and imaging consultation including onsite CT and MRI Scans Critical Care Service (ICU) is overseen and provided by a board certified specialist in critical care. Cardiology: Referral appointments and advanced procedures including diagnostic and corrective procedures overseen by Dr Mike O'Grady. Anesthesiology: Anesthesiology overseen by board certified anesthesiologist. Rehabilitation: Rehab and Pain control provided by Dr Tara Edwards- Your pet’s well-being is our highest priority. Calgary Wildlife Rehabilitation Society
The Calgary Wildlife Rehabilitation Society was established in 1993 to provide professional veterinary care to injured and orphaned wildlife. Each year we receive 2200+ injured and orphaned wild animals and respond to wildlife-related calls from the public. In addition Calgary Wildlife provides motivational, skill-building experiences for volunteers and valuable outreach and education services to the community. Calgary Wildlife is a registered charity and the only veterinary based wildlife hospital located within The City of Calgary. We are Calgary’s wildlife hospital. Mission The Calgary Wildlife Rehabilitation Society is dedicated to providing professional veterinary treatment of injured and orphaned wildlife, valuable outreach and education services to the community and engaging all volunteers in motivational work and skill building experience. Vision Calgary Wildlife strives to be recognized as a provincial leader in the delivery of professional wildlife rehabilitation services as well as community outreach and education related to human-wildlife interactions.
